|

S25 – Elemente de bază utilizate în exersarea algoritmilor

Fișa de lucru: Elemente de bază utilizate în exersarea algoritmilor

Clasa: a VI-a
Durata: 1 oră
Subiect: Identificarea elementelor fundamentale utilizate în construirea și exersarea algoritmilor


Obiective

  • Să înțelegem conceptul de algoritm și structura sa de bază.
  • Să identificăm elementele esențiale pentru exersarea algoritmilor.
  • Să aplicăm noțiunile prin exerciții practice simple.

Activitatea 1: Ce este un algoritm?

Instrucțiuni:

  1. Ascultă explicațiile profesorului:
    • Un algoritm este o succesiune de pași logici care rezolvă o problemă.
    • Exemple din viața cotidiană: rețeta de gătit, instrucțiuni pentru montarea unui obiect.
  2. Discută: Cum ai descrie algoritmul pentru a face un ceai?

Întrebare: De ce este important să urmezi pașii în ordine într-un algoritm?


Activitatea 2: Structura unui algoritm

Instrucțiuni:

  1. Notează cele trei părți principale ale unui algoritm:
    • Intrare: Informațiile inițiale necesare (ex.: datele de intrare).
    • Procesare: Operațiile efectuate asupra datelor (ex.: calcule, comparații).
    • Ieșire: Rezultatul obținut (ex.: afișarea unui răspuns).
  2. Exemplu:
    • Problema: Calculează suma a două numere.
    • Intrare: Numerele A și B.
    • Procesare: Suma = A + B.
    • Ieșire: Afișează Suma.

Exercițiu: Scrie structura unui algoritm pentru a afla dacă un număr este par sau impar.


Activitatea 3: Tipuri de date utilizate în algoritmi

Instrucțiuni:

  1. Notează cele mai utilizate tipuri de date:
    • Numere: Reprezintă valori numerice (ex.: întregi, reale).
    • Text: Șiruri de caractere (ex.: numele unei persoane).
    • Boolean: Adevărat/Fals (True/False).
  2. Exemple:
    • Data de naștere: Text
    • Numărul elevilor dintr-o clasă: Număr întreg
    • Este un număr par?: Boolean

Exercițiu: Identifică tipurile de date pentru următoarele probleme:

  • Vârsta unei persoane.
  • Numele unei școli.
  • Verificarea unei parole corecte.

Activitatea 4: Exercițiu practic

Instrucțiuni:

  1. Creează algoritmul pentru următoarea problemă:
    • Problema: Găsește cel mai mare dintre două numere.
    • Intrare: Două numere A și B.
    • Procesare: Compară A și B. Dacă A > B, cel mai mare este A; altfel, este B.
    • Ieșire: Afișează numărul mai mare.

Exercițiu suplimentar: Desenează o diagramă logică (flowchart) pentru acest algoritm.


Tema pentru acasă:

  1. Scrie algoritmul pentru a calcula aria unui dreptunghi, având lungimea și lățimea ca date de intrare.
  2. Desenează structura algoritmului folosind simboluri de diagramă logică.

Similar Posts

Lasă un răspuns

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*